Concrete Steps to Optimize Databases for Customer Retention in Certifications

1. Map the Customer Journey to Database Access Points

Where does your marketing team rely on database queries? Enrollment status, exam scores, renewal reminders, and personalized content suggestions are typical touchpoints. Mapping these allows you to identify slow queries that create bottlenecks in customer engagement.

2. Index Smartly and Partition Data Strategically

Why index? Because it slashes retrieval time by allowing the database to find rows without scanning the entire table. For certifications, indexing on candidate ID, test dates, and certification status makes the most sense. Partitioning your database—dividing it into smaller, manageable pieces based on certification category or region—minimizes the data each query scans.

3. Employ Caching for Frequent Queries

How often do your marketing tools pull the same data repeatedly? For example, if your renewal campaign dashboard pulls the same subset of users daily, caching this data reduces load time and database strain, improving responsiveness.

4. Automate Regular Data Cleanup and Archival

Old, irrelevant data can bloat your database and slow queries. Create automated scripts that archive or delete records like expired certifications beyond retention periods. This keeps your database lean and fast, directly affecting user experience positively.

6. Monitor Performance Metrics Closely

Which metrics matter most in database optimization for customer retention? Slow query rates, cache hit ratios, and transaction times directly correlate to user experience. Set up dashboards with thresholds that alert you before issues impact learners.

Common Mistakes That Undermine Database Optimization Efforts

Have you ever rushed optimization without considering the unique structure of your certification data? Not all professional-certification databases are alike. Applying a one-size-fits-all indexing or partitioning method can backfire, making the system less efficient.

Another pitfall is neglecting compliance. Certification data often includes personal and sensitive information. Optimizations must respect regulations like GDPR and CCPA—if not, you risk fines and losing customer trust.

Also, be wary of over-caching. While caching speeds access, outdated cache can serve stale information, which in certification contexts (exam results, renewal deadlines) can be disastrous. Strategize cache refresh intervals carefully.

How to Know If Your Optimization Is Boosting Retention

Measuring the ROI of database optimization can seem abstract. But here’s the practical angle: monitor churn rates alongside system performance metrics. If renewal and recertification rates rise after database enhancements, you have direct evidence of ROI.

One mid-market edtech firm specializing in IT certifications reduced their database query times from 300ms to 60ms through indexing and partitioning. Over six months, their renewal rate increased by 8 percentage points, adding significant revenue without extra marketing spend.

database optimization techniques metrics that matter for edtech?

What numbers should hold your attention? Focus on:

  • Average query response time for certification-related lookups
  • Cache hit ratio (percentage of queries served from cache)
  • Percentage of queries taking longer than acceptable threshold (e.g., 200ms)
  • Data freshness or latency in reflecting latest exam results or user progress
  • Customer churn and renewal rates linked to data performance

Tracking these metrics in tandem paints a clear picture of optimization impact on customer retention.

database optimization techniques vs traditional approaches in edtech?

How do modern optimization methods compare to traditional ones? Traditional approaches often rely on manual indexing and batch processing. Modern techniques incorporate automation, real-time analytics, and cloud scalability tailored to learner engagement patterns.

For example, traditional databases might struggle with sudden spikes in certification renewals before expiry deadlines. Cloud-based optimized systems with elastic scaling handle load spikes smoothly, preventing delays that frustrate customers.
